  12. 5 minutes ago, fret_man said:

    I have Waves Mercury fully Wup'd and fully v14. I have the latest Waves Central update (just updated yesterday). When I open my DAW and search thru the many Waves VST inserts, I do not see Harmony or Waves Harmony or anything else that hints at Harmony. Where is it? How do I insert it?

    Thanks!

    Have you gone to the waves website and in your account details clicked the "get latest version" ? - it won't add the extra plugins until you do this.

    then you need to go back to Waves Central and reinstall/reactivate...it's a pain but that's the procedure.
